Firewall management vendor Tufin Technologies has moved to a tiered channel model and has created a new training programme.

The Israel-based vendor was founded in 2003 by a breakaway group of Check Point executives and now boasts more than 375 customers and 140 resellers globally - including Integralis, Didata and Nebulas Security.

Resellers will now be classified as Gold and Silver, determining their level of incentives, sales enablement and technical training.

Further reading

The vendor has also launched the Tufin Certified Security Expert (TCSE) programme to help resellers support customers on the full breadth of its product range.

The first series of one-day TCSE training courses will be held at various locations in major European and US cities between September and November.

Nebulas Security managing director Nick Garlick said the initiative would help resellers to demonstrate the value of automating policy management of firewalls and other network devices.

“The firewall and network management market is growing rapidly, yet Tufin has kept a laser-like focus on its partners, enabling us to get more leads, more business and technical support, and more high-margin deals,” Garlick said.

Shaul Efraim, vice president of products, marketing and business development at Tufin Technologies, said: “Our channel partners have been critical to our ability to understand and respond to market trends. We look forward to working with them to maintain our thought and market leadership in 2010 and beyond.”
